Man dies after driving car off the road, hitting another car in Bel Air

A Columbia man died Tuesday afternoon after driving off the road and hitting another car. 

According to troopers, Jeffrey Vande-Ryt, 48, was driving a Ford F-250 pick-up truck north on Mountain Road, in the area of Reckford Road Park. 

For reasons that are unknown, Vande-Ryt drove onto the shoulder and then off the road. The truck continued to drive along Mountain Road in the grass drainage, when it hit an Infiniti SUV that was stopped and preparing to turn. 

Vande-Ryt was not wearing a seatbelt and was partially ejected from the car. He was pronounced dead on the scene. 

The driver of the Infiniti, Martina Rambal, 39, was transported to the University of Maryland Shock Trauma Center by a state police helicopter. 

No reports have been released on Rambal's condition. 

Mountain Road was closed for three hours after the crash.
